sendmail DSN用户未知

有没有可能redirect/丢弃未知用户的电子邮件,而不是发送回发送给用户的拒绝消息,用户是未知的?

我不想使用任何milter为此目的或任何发件人validation工具。 sendmail有这个能力吗?

你想要的sendmail选项叫做LUSER_RELAY。 要发送给未知用户的所有邮件在本地系统上都是“未知”,你可以把这一行放在你的mc文件中:

define( LUSER_RELAY', local:unknown')dnl

一旦你build立了一个新的sendmail.cf文件,你将得到一个指定发送给未知用户的所有电子邮件的目的地的行:

DLlocal:未知

永远不要处理电子邮件,在目标用户的家中放置一个.forward文件:

| 的/ dev / null的